Windows 10 Activation Commands Used in TXT CMD Scripts
The windows 10 activator txt cmd uses several important commands to activate Windows 10. These commands are part of the Windows 10 activation techniques embedded in the script.
Common commands include:
slmgr /ipk
to install the product keyslmgr /ato
to activate Windows onlineslmgr /dli
to display license information
These commands work together to complete the activation process smoothly. Using these Windows 10 activation options in a script helps automate what would otherwise be a manual and time-consuming task.
Digital License Activation vs Traditional Product Key Activation
Windows 10 activation approaches include two main types: digital license activation and traditional product key activation. The windows 10 activator txt cmd can support both methods depending on the script’s design.
- Digital License Activation: This method links the Windows license to the hardware, allowing automatic activation without entering a product key.
- Traditional Product Key Activation: This requires entering a 25-character key to activate Windows.
Both methods are valid Windows 10 activation techniques. The windows 10 activator txt cmd often focuses on automating the traditional product key activation but can also handle digital licenses in some cases.

Are Windows 10 Activation Alternatives Safe and Legal?
Windows 10 activation alternatives, like free activator scripts or keys, are often used by people who want to avoid buying a license. However, many of these alternatives are not legal and can put your computer at risk.
Using unauthorized activation methods can lead to security issues, software malfunctions, or even legal trouble. It’s best to use official Windows 10 activation strategies to keep your system safe and fully supported.
If you want to avoid paying for a key, look for legitimate options like digital licenses or discounts from Microsoft.
